: To meet modern environmental standards, Google introduced three distinct power settings: Low Energy , Optimized , and Increased Energy . These modes allow users to minimize standby power consumption to 2W or less or maintain persistent network connections for smart home features. According to reports, Android TV 14 delivers improved startup times—shaving up to 4 seconds off the boot process in some cases. The OS also reduces storage usage by approximately 20%, meaning more room for your apps and content. Additionally, Google has enhanced home screen scrolling, improved data loading speeds, and shortened the launcher’s cold start time, creating a more fluid user experience overall.

To understand why a Zenith-branded TV running Android 14 is such a captivating concept, it's worth revisiting the incredible history of the company. Founded in Chicago in 1918 as a small producer of amateur radio equipment, Zenith grew into a titan of American manufacturing and a beacon of innovation.
